Our client is currently recruiting for the position of Senior C&I Engineer, based in Aberdeen.

Responsibilities:
* Failure and incident investigation / Root Cause Analysis (RCA).
* Approval of Management of Change (MOC).
* Regulatory assurance.
* Review and accept or reject deviations to codes, standards, practices, and guidelines.
* Approve changes to Ops procedures and manuals.
* Review and endorse MEDIUM level Operations Risk Assessments (ORA).
* Check and approve changes to critical docs (e.g. P&IDs and C&Es).
* Support in the ranking and management of facilities risks.
* Support in the development of improvement opportunities.
* Support project scopes and development.
* Scoping, estimating and drafting of Statement of Requirements (SOR) for Modification Projects.
* Scope and support external study work.
* Close out or verify actions (e.g. Events, MyHSES).
* Contract management of key service contracts.
* Approve repair plans (anomalies/breakdown).
* Identify and endorse shutdown activities as required.
* Visibly support a process safety ambition and hydrocarbon leak prevention plan.
* Actively support technology development and evaluation.
* Act as a conduit between Technical Authorities, Performance Standards and front-line engineers and technicians to improve delivery of safe operations.
* Actively support an Incident Free Workplace mindset.
* Visibly contribute to integrated planning and department objectives.
* Development of AFE's (Approval For Expenditure) as required.

Experience & Qualifications:
* Engineering qualification.
* Substantial engineering and operations and maintenance experience in oil and gas.
* Very high level of technical and engineering competence.
* Experience with operational technologies such as PLCs, SCADA, DCS and Safety Systems (SIS, F&G, ESD, PSS/PSD).
* TUV Functional Safety Engineer certification or equivalent experience in the application of IEC 61511.
* Ability to review and analyse technical and operational data effectively.
* Knowledge with Cyber Security Standards including IEC 62443 and OG 86.
